CIVIL WAR
AMONG CHINESE 5 478th IN TWENTY YEARS (United Press Association —By Electric Telegraph—Copyright.) (Received this day at 9.25 a.m) SHANGHAI, October 7. A message states that Nanking is seriously exercised at .the conditions at Szeyhuan, where a fresh’ civil war has broken out betv, sen General Liuhsiang Chung King and his uncle, General Limvenhui, owing to the former’s continual seizing of munitions transported via Yangtze River for the latter, making the 478th. civil war in that province in the past 20 years.
